Tokenization services are security solutions that replace sensitive data elements, such as payment card numbers or personally identifiable information, with non-sensitive equivalents known as tokens. These tokens retain the format and utility of the original data but have no exploitable value outside the specific tokenization system, reducing the risk of data exposure in the event of a breach.
Core capabilities of tokenization services include the secure generation, mapping, and storage of tokens, as well as controlled detokenization processes for authorized users or systems. These services are often integrated with payment processing, data storage, and application environments to minimize the presence of sensitive data across enterprise infrastructure. Technical scope may also include compliance support for regulations such as PCI DSS, GDPR, or HIPAA, depending on the data types involved.
Organizations that handle large volumes of sensitive data—such as financial institutions, healthcare providers, and e-commerce businesses—typically use tokenization services to mitigate data breach risks and streamline compliance efforts. Unlike encryption, which transforms data using cryptographic algorithms and requires key management, tokenization substitutes data entirely, ensuring that sensitive information is not present in the environment where tokens are used.
